Workflow
The workflow starts with the business goal. Write what the clinic needs the website to do in the next ninety days: create trust, support sales calls, validate demand, rank for specific terms, help investors understand the product, or convert paid traffic.
The second step is the page and content inventory. Save the page list, owner, draft status, proof requirement, target keyword where relevant, CTA, and tracking event. A clinic website fails quietly when nobody owns these details.
The third step is the build system. Choose components, CMS structure, performance rules, form handling, analytics, accessibility checks, and deployment workflow before the site becomes a collection of unreviewed pages.
The fourth step is launch timing. Do not run traffic or announce a redesign until forms, mobile layout, metadata, images, links, redirects, analytics, and post-submit states are tested. The cost of broken first impressions is higher than the cost of QA.

Common mistakes
Designing before the offer is clear
Visual polish cannot rescue a vague offer. The clinic should know the audience, promise, proof, CTA, and measurement plan before final UI polish.
Leaving SEO and analytics until the end
Titles, content structure, internal links, forms, events, and dashboards need to be built into the launch plan, not added after the announcement.
Ignoring mobile and performance pressure
Large media, third-party scripts, unstable layouts, and untested forms can damage both user experience and campaign efficiency.

FAQ
Why can this website cost more than a brochure site?
Because positioning, copy, proof, booking workflows, content structure, analytics, performance, and launch QA all affect scope.
Is Next.js always necessary?
No. It is useful when the website needs speed, custom workflows, structured content, integrations, and room to grow.
What drives cost most?
Scope, copy, proof, CMS, booking, design system, technical SEO, analytics, migration, performance, and QA drive cost.
